For food, it typically means the product is free from prohibited items (like pork or alcohol) and, for meat, slaughtered by cutting the throat while invoking Allah's name, allowing blood to drain. Certification extends beyond meat to processed foods, cosmetics, medicines, and even non-food items like packaging or building materials in some cases.7fe87d
In India, Halal certification is not mandatory for domestic sales. There is no single government-regulated national body for it. Private organizations—often linked to Islamic groups like Jamiat Ulama-i-Hind Halal Trust, Halal India, or Halal Council of India—issue certificates. Some are recognized internationally, but many operate without unified oversight.
The Market Reality in India
India has a large Muslim population (over 200 million), creating genuine demand for Halal-compliant products. The domestic Halal food market is valued in hundreds of millions to billions of USD depending on definitions,
with growth projected due to rising awareness and exports.
Major companies (including Reliance, Tata, Adani, and many FMCG brands) get products certified to tap into this market and for exports, especially meat to Gulf countries. India's Halal meat exports have been worth billions annually. Certification helps access the global Islamic economy (trillions worldwide).
